When i tried to pull my dodge caravan (2000) out of the parking lot after a heavy raining day, i found the power steering didn't work. i could go forward or backward, but could not turn, or could turn only very slowly (i could hear the wheel kind of making clicking sound when i tried to turn). after driving very slowly on the parking lot and tried to turn slowly several time, the steering finally got back. i googled online and found many people have the same problem, mostly with a dodge, but also some other cars. http://www.topix.com/forum/autos/dodge-grand-caravan/tc37vjlp6md4pohvj since i don't drive much and mostly park my vehicle in the garage, i don't have much problem. it has happened a couple more times after the first incident, but it usually returns normal after i make several small turns in the parking lot. but this morning, it happened again, after i parked my car outside with an overnight rain, and the wheel was still kind of stuck after i drove about 5 miles, making several turns on purpose in the neighborhood. it's still pouring outside, i don't know if i can get the steering back to normal after work. since i am not the only people having the same problem, i hope the manufacturer could help us solve the problem. thanks!
2000 dodge caravan, eastbound when left front tire came off of the vehicle. unit 1 came to final rest on the right berm. tire was located on the westbound side by ohio turnpike maintenance. *bf there was damage to the left front tire, left front hub and left front quarter panel. ( ohio traffic crash report # 10-0550-90)*jb
